
Gordon Named BSC Freshman of the Week
1/4/2010 12:00:00 AM | Men's Basketball
The Big South Conference announced today that Liberty guard Evan Gordon has been named the Crons Brand Freshman of the Week for his performances in last week's contests against UCF, Buffalo and VMI.
Gordon (Indianapolis, Ind.) averaged 16.0 points, 3.3 rebounds, 3.0 assists, shot 50.0 percent from the floor (18-of-36) and 85.7 percent from the free throw line (6-of-7) in three games for the Flames. After collecting seven points, five rebounds and two assists against UCF on Dec. 29, he tallied a team-high 17 points against Buffalo on Dec. 30, going 3-of-6 from beyond the arc and 7-of-12 overall from the field, in addition to two steals. Gordon led Liberty to a 110-102 victory over VMI this past Saturday with a career-high 24 points on 9-of-13 shooting (69.2 percent). He also handed out six assists and blocked one shot against the Keydets.
Gordon is the second player to be named Big South Freshman of the Week this season, joining forward Antwan Burrus, who earned the honor on Dec. 14.
Gordon and the Flames return to action Thursday night, as they travel to Clinton, S.C., taking on Presbyterian. Tipoff is set for 7 p.m. inside the Templeton Center.
